About agriculture in Rubielos de Mora

Rubielos de Mora is a historic municipality located in the Gúdar-Javalambre comarca, within the province of Teruel in the southern part of the Aragon region, Spain. Situated at an elevation of over 900 meters above sea level, the town is nestled in a mountainous, rugged landscape characterized by the deep gorges of the Mijares and Rubielos rivers. The surrounding countryside features a mix of high-altitude plains, pine forests, oak woodlands, and rocky terrain typical of the Iberian System mountain range.

The agricultural sector in the region is shaped by its high altitude and Mediterranean-mountain climate. Traditional dryland farming dominates the arable land, with cereals and forage crops being primary cultivations, alongside small-scale orchards and vegetable gardens. Livestock farming is highly significant, particularly intensive pork production which feeds the famous Teruel ham industry, as well as extensive sheep farming for Ternasco lamb. Additionally, the area has become increasingly renowned for truffle cultivation, particularly the highly valued black truffle (Tuber melanosporum) grown in specialized oak plantations.

For agronomists and farm workers, Rubielos de Mora offers opportunities centered primarily on livestock management, forestry, and truffle cultivation. Seasonal labor demand peaks during the winter truffle harvest from November to March, as well as during the summer grain harvests. Workers should expect a cold, continental mountain climate in winter and warm, dry summers, with a quiet, rural lifestyle in a well-preserved historic community. Agronomists can find roles in modernizing livestock operations or managing mycorrhizal oak plantations for truffle production.
